"Battery Lifetime Estimator" delivered to Raytheon Missile Systems
Modeling and Prediction Battery Lifetime of Wireless Sensor Nodes: Wireless sensors, powered by chemical battery, are often left unattended after deploying (e.g., in the jungle to monitor habitants, or in battlefields to track movement of enemy's troops). It is critical to model and predict the longevity of the network, that depends on lifetime of every sensor node. Lifetime of a sensor network depends on both the battery lifetime of individual nodes and how information is routed. Knowing how a battery discharges versus various traffic profiles allows us to configure the optimal duty cycle for each individual sensor (by leveraging the nonlinear discharge curve of chemical batteries). The optimal duty cycle of a sensor, in terms of network lifetime, depends on its position and how much data is relayed through it. In this project, we provide a software that can predict battery lifetime of a sensor under arbitrary discharge profiles (i.e., duty cycle) within 5% margin of DUALFOIL. The developed software is much faster (in minutes) than DUALFOIL (in days for a desktop with Intel Core 2 CPU 1.83GHz and 2G Ram) and allows one to optimize sensor mote's lifetime without requiring low-level simulations.
